Duncan Forbes of Culloden (1685 - 1747)

Duncan Forbes of Culloden (1685 - 1747) Scottish politician who fought the Jacobite pretenders to the British throne and supported the Hanoverian succession. Engraving from " A Biographical Dictionary of Eminent Scotsmen" by Thomas Thomson (1870)

This engraving from "A Biographical Dictionary of Eminent Scotsmen" by Thomas Thomson (1870) captures the essence of Duncan Forbes of Culloden (1685 - 1747), a Scottish politician who played a significant role in British history. Sitting proudly in a formal chair, Forbes exudes confidence and determination as he gazes directly at the camera with a warm smile. His curly hair, impeccably styled wig, and distinguished attire reflect his status as an influential figure in politics. Forbes was renowned for his unwavering support for the Hanoverian succession and his valiant fight against Jacobite pretenders to the British throne. This portrait immortalizes him as a symbol of Scottish culture and political prowess during this era.
